Pair Trading with HP and Angel Oak
The main advantage of trading using opposite HP and Angel Oak posit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if HP position performs unexpectedly, Angel Oak can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Angel Oak will offset losses from the drop in Angel Oak's long position.The idea behind HP Inc and Angel Oak Mortgage Backed p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side).
